Mattia Caldara did not achieve great results with AC Milan due to many injuries and physical problems.
The player left the Rossoneri on loan with an option to buy, but he never impressed or regained his form at Atalanta, which made the Bergamo side choose not to exercise their right to activate the buyout clause in the agreement with Milan.
Now, Caldara is back to training with the Rossoneri squad with a contract due to expire in the summer of year 2023.
The Italian 27-year-old centre-back is reportedly being monitored by some Serie A clubs, like Torino.
As pointed out by Calciomercato.com, Torino is working to bolster their defensive department, and their technical director has just the plan to convince the former Juventus man.
The manager of the club is playing the card of the new coach Ivan Juric in the hopes of convincing Caldara to make the switch to Torino and accept the offer.
The Croatian coach's game is very similar to that of Gian Piero Gasperini, the coach with whom Caldara expressed himself best in the earlier years at Atalanta, concludes the source.
